About Edward J. Kosnik
Edward J. Kosnik is a scholar working on Neurology, Cellular and Molecular Neuroscience and Genetics, having authored 40 papers that have together received 2.1k ind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Spinal Fractures and Fixation Techniques (7 papers), Cerebrospinal fluid and hydrocephalus (7 papers), Intracranial Aneurysms: Treatment and Complications (6 papers), Spinal Dysraphism and Malformations (6 papers), Traumatic Brain Injury and Neurovascular Disturbances (4 papers), Glioma Diagnosis and Treatment (3 papers), Neurosurgical Procedures and Complications (3 papers) and Chromatin Remodeling and Cancer (2 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Neurology (1.1k citations), Genetics (270 citations) and Pathology and Forensic Medicine (297 citations). Edward J. Kosnik has collaborated with scholars based in United States and Italy. Frequent co-authors include William E. Hunt, Carole A. Miller, Martin P. Sayers, Carl P. Boesel, Denis R. King, Ann Dietrich, Mary Jo Bowman, Margaret E. Ginn‐Pease, Janet W. Bay and Stephen Hill.
